Cyclometalated N‐Heterocyclic Carbene Platinum(II) Complexes with Bridging Pyrazolates: Enhanced Photophysical Properties of Binuclear Blue Emitters

Abstract The synthesis of the first examples of phosphorescent binuclear cyclometalated N‐heterocyclic carbene C^C* μ‐pyrazolate platinum(II) complexes are reported and the photophysical characterization of the single isomers is described. The complexes exhibit a strong phosphorescent emission in the blue region of the visible spectrum with very high quantum yields of up to 86 % at room temperature (PMMA film) and 98 % at 77 K (2‐MeTHF).
